Duties and Responsibilities

The Department of Security and Risk Management (DSRM) is investing in digital transformation across its security information management and operational functions, with a growing emphasis on geospatial capability and the responsible use of artificial intelligence. This internship supports that work by contributing to the development and support of GIS products and AI-assisted tools used across D/FSRM’s five field offices. By the end of the placement, the intern will have gained practical experience in:

Developing and supporting GIS products, spatial datasets and map-based analysis within a UN operational context

Applying AI and automation tools to real security data and geospatial workflows

Working within a humanitarian data management environment with complex operational requirements Under the supervision of the Security Information Analyst, the intern will:

Support the development and maintenance of GIS products for D/FSRM, including spatial datasets, geodatabases, map-based visualisations and operational mapping outputs for the five field offices

Support the agency’s use of artificial intelligence by helping to integrate AI features — such as natural language processing, automated classification and AI-assisted analysis — into existing and new D/FSRM tools and geospatial products

Contribute to the design and development of low-code applications (e.g. Power Apps and Dataverse) that support D/FSRM’s GIS and data management needs

Contribute to the documentation of system logic, data models and user guidance materials

Support testing and iteration of tools with input from field users

Assist with data visualisation and reporting tasks in Power BI where relevant

Perform any other related tasks as assigned by the supervisor

Qualifications/special skills

Applicants must be enrolled in or have recently graduated from (within one year) a Master's degree programme in a relevant field. Relevant fields include but are not limited to:

Geographic Information Systems (GIS) or Geomatics

Information Management or Information Systems

Computer Science or Data Science

A related technical or interdisciplinary field Demonstrated experience with GIS software and spatial data management (e.g. ArcGIS, QGIS) is a particular advantage. Familiarity with any of the following is desirable but not required: applied use of AI tools and large language models; Microsoft Power Platform (Power Apps, Power Automate, Power BI, Copilot Studio); or Dataverse.

Additional Information

The intern must provide proof of valid medical and accident insurance and a certificate of good health prior to commencement of the internship. The intern is required to adhere to UNRWA's Code of Ethics and all applicable standards of conduct throughout the placement. The internship is unpaid and does not constitute an employment relationship with UNRWA. Full-time interns are entitled to two days of leave per month. The internship does not carry any expectation of employment following its conclusion.

Intern Specific text

Interns are not financially remunerated by the United Nations. Costs and arrangements for travel, visas, accommodation and living expenses are the responsibility of interns or their sponsoring institutions. Interns who are not citizens or permanent residents of the country where the internship is undertaken, may be required to obtain the appropriate visa and work/employment authorization. Successful candidates should discuss their specific visa requirements before accepting the internship offer.
